About the Book
A controversial title for a controversial subject. The sad reality of HIV is depicted by lifestories of a Doctor who becomes HIV positive while in the line of duty and a very successful businessman tragicly infected with HIV in a moment of uninhibited lust.
The two characters represent the two sides of the same coin-one infected innocently while one infected by giving in to his human desires to procreate, BUT both are infected with HIV. The way they ended up with HIV is pretty much irrelevant.
These tragic events in their lives affect both characters in different ways. Just as tragic are the affects on the lives of their loved ones and the subsequent sequence of events.
These catastrophic events lead to the question if there is any hope in this dire state of affairs. Form there the title: Hope In Vain.
This sad, but at times humorous life drama leaves the readers to answer this controversial question for themselves.
The story is set in two countries (South Africa and England) and as an unexpected twist of fate join as one story in the end.
By dealing with this controversial issue of HIV in a way depicting ordinary lives, it destroys the barriers of these hush-hush issues, encouraging readers to think about issues, setting the reader's mind free to explore fundamental questions surrounding HIV.

About the Author
JB Müller was born in South Africa. He has a keen interest in nature. After graduating in South Africa he came to work in St Helens near Liverpool (UK). Always intrigued by good literature he embarked on this journey to write Hope In Vain.
